§ 119 — House coach
§ 119. House coach. Any vehicle motivated by a power connected\ntherewith or propelled by a power within itself, which is or can be used\nas the home or living abode or habitation of one or more persons, either\ntemporarily or permanently. In the application of this chapter to house\ncoaches, a house coach propelled by a power within itself shall be\ndeemed a motor vehicle, a house coach motivated by a power connected\ntherewith shall be deemed a trailer, and all house coaches shall be\ndeemed vehicles.\n
